🧐 Know Your Enemy: The Fake Factor
Let’s face it, knockoff markets are thriving like never before. 😅 But don’t panic! While counterfeiters may try their hardest to replicate that iconic monogram pattern, they often miss key details that scream “fake.” Here’s how you can spot them:
• **Material Matters**: A real Louis Vuitton scarf is made with premium silk or cashmere, feeling soft and luxurious against your skin. Knockoffs usually feel rougher or have a plasticky sheen. 🤢
• **Colors That Pop**: Authentic scarves boast vibrant colors that won’t fade easily after washing. Counterfeit versions tend to look washed out or overly bright in unnatural ways. 🎨➡️❌
🕵️♀️ Investigate the Details: Labels & Serial Numbers
Every authentic Louis Vuitton scarf comes with its own unique identity card – the label and serial number. These aren’t just random strings of letters; they’re part of what makes each piece special.
• **Check the Tag**: Look closely at the tag sewn into the fabric. Genuine items will feature crisp lettering without smudging or uneven spacing. If it looks messy, run away fast! 🏃♂️💨
• **Serial Number Magic**: Each scarf has a distinct serial number printed either on the tag or inside the packaging box. Fakes might omit this entirely or print something nonsensical. Pro tip: Compare yours online with verified examples. 🔍🔗
🌟 Beyond Basics: Other Red Flags
Still unsure? There are more subtle signs hiding in plain sight:
• **Edges Should Be Perfect**: Hand-rolled edges are standard on all Louis Vuitton scarves. Machine-made imitations lack this craftsmanship and appear jagged or uneven along the borders. ✂️➡️⚠️
• **Monograms Must Align**: Those famous interlocking Ls and Vs should fit together seamlessly across the entire design. Misaligned patterns are immediate giveaways. 🕵️♂️💡
Bonus tip: Always buy directly from authorized retailers or trusted secondhand platforms to minimize risk. 💰🤝
